Women of the House aired on CBS from January 4 to August 18, 1995. The series starred Delta Burke, reprising her role of Suzanne Sugarbaker, who had reconciled with producers of Designing Women after a bitter, highly publicized, off-screen battle. Susan Powter was initially announced as a cast member of the series.
Suzanne Sugarbaker assumed the post of the U.S. House of Representatives. She formed an unusual bond with then-current President Bill Clinton. Teri Garr starred as Suzanne's press secretary Sissy Emerson. Patricia Heaton portrayed Natty Hollingsworth, a snooty, conservative administrative assistant whose married Congressman boyfriend was serving a prison sentence.
